Bradley the canine received a quite particular celebration for his newest birthday, with proprietor Ashley Sherman throwing him his very personal ‘bark mitzvah’.

Ashley, who was raised in a Reform congregation and values her heritage, hosted the doggy model of a Bar Mitzvah as a manner of celebrating her Chihuahua’s big day.

Bradley was papped in his personal kippah (head masking) and tallit (scarf) alongside stuffed toys to symbolize the Torah and a rabbi.

Ashley, 34, says: ‘I don’t have youngsters, so I'm a fairly “further” mum to my canine, they’re those who get celebrated and supported.

‘It’s additionally good to have the ability to join with my heritage and produce it via with my canine. I do know it’s solely slightly factor, however I had a blast with it.

‘We’re going to throw a “Bark Mitzvah” social gathering on the canine park as soon as the climate begins getting hotter and invite all of his little canine pals to come back.’

‘There was no Rabbi concerned,’ she provides. ‘There's a superb line between enjoyable and sacrilegious that I didn’t need to cross.’

When Ashley, from Cleveland, Ohio, shared the images of Bradley on Fb, she impressed canine lovers to observe her lead and have fun their pet’s coming of age.

Ashley, who works as an industrial recruiter, now plans to have a celebration with Bradley’s doggy buds to have fun the event as soon as the climate warms up.

She says: ‘Bradley’s thirteenth birthday was on April tenth.

‘I used to be raised Jewish – I had my Bat Mitzvah, my brother had his Bar Mitzvah. I used to be raised in a Reform congregation, so we’re a bit extra relaxed about it.

‘I attend synagogue on the vacations, my religion is a vital factor to me.

‘I had been speaking about having a ‘Bark Mitzvah’ just about ever since I received him as a pet. I simply thought that it will be a enjoyable, cute thought.

‘Bradley’s getting older, so it’s actually significant to have these footage of him.

‘Plenty of instances, folks will wait till their canine is ill earlier than they get photographs finished. I simply needed to verify I received him at his prime.

‘He had his personal kippah and tallit, I used to be capable of get them off Amazon. I assume there’s a marketplace for “Bark Mitzvahs” on-line.

‘Judging by the feedback I used to be getting, I've a sense that “Bark Mitzvahs” are going to be the brand new scorching factor.’

Ashley additionally has six-year-old Chihuahua Freddie, and plans to throw him his personal Bark Mitzvah when the time comes.

‘Freddie goes to be seven in June, so he’s a bit off from his Bark Mitzvah however he’ll get one when he’s of age too,’ she says.

Sadly, Ashley’s mother and father had been unable to attend however had been substituted by toys for the photographs.

Ashley says: ‘My mom, Bradley’s actual bubbe [grandmother], is ill and is within the hospital, and my dad, Bradley’s zayde [grandfather] was staying together with her there, so that they had been unable to attend.

‘So we had them there in spirit represented by the dolls.

‘Within the image with the toys, there may be the mensch [person of integrity and honour] on the bench, representing the rabbi.’

The pictures had been shared on Fb on April 14th, the publish has been shared greater than 2,500 instances and has racked up greater than 3,600 feedback.

Ashley provides: ‘I used to be completely blown away by the response I received. I simply thought it was a foolish little factor I did with my little household, however it blew up far more than I anticipated.

‘Folks had been loving it, they had been wishing him “Muzzle-tov”. I noticed lots of people commenting that it was one of the best factor they’d ever seen on the web.’
